Paramagnetic Scattering of Neutrons from a Heisenberg System

T. H. Kwon and H. A. Gersch

  • School of Physics, Georgia Institute of Technology, Atlanta, Georgia

Phys. Rev. 167, 458 – Published 10 March, 1968

DOI: https://doi.org/10.1103/PhysRev.167.458

Abstract

The neutron paramagnetic scattering function for a Heisenberg system is evaluated in the high-temperature limit and in the cluster model. The numerical results for several different cluster configurations are presented for various values of scattering vector. The scattering function for a simple cubic lattice with spin ½ is compared with the frequency distribution functions derived from the method of moments by de Gennes and by Collins and Marshall.
